Crisis in Jenin: Medical Services Struggle Amid Israeli Raids; Global Cyberattacks and Geopolitical Tensions Intensify

Israeli raids in Jenin disrupt vital medical services, leading to 14 deaths, amidst escalating tensions with precise airstrikes on Iranian sites. Meanwhile, Chinese cyberespionage targets US campaigns, prompting security investigations.
The situation in Jenin is becoming increasingly dire as Israeli raids have severely hampered medical services, leaving many without vital care like dialysis and chemotherapy. Consequently, at least 14 individuals have tragically lost their lives due to the lack of emergency health services.

Meanwhile, tensions are further amplified by reports of Chinese hackers targeting the phones of Donald Trump and Kamala Harris's campaigns in a broader cyberespionage effort. This has prompted investigations into potential breaches of US telecommunications by these state-linked actors, continuing a pattern of cyber interference.

At the same time, Israel has conducted precise airstrikes on Iranian military sites, escalating the conflict amidst ongoing regional tensions. These strikes, which follow provocations from Iran including a missile barrage, highlight the intensifying military confrontations between the two nations.

Shifting the focus to the US political arena, Beyoncé and Kelly Rowland have thrown their support behind Kamala Harris, prioritizing maternal health issues and freedom. Their backing at a Houston rally underscores growing concerns over Texas' strict abortion laws and their impact on maternal and infant mortality rates.

Across the globe, Japan's Prime Minister Shigeru Ishiba is in a tight battle to maintain the ruling coalition's majority in a crucial election. The stakes are high, as failing to secure a majority could endanger Ishiba's leadership amidst scrutiny over party scandals and representation issues.

Finally, in London, the city braces for potentially tense demonstrations as the "Unite the Kingdom" rally, featuring right-wing activists, coincides with counter-protests by anti-racism groups. Authorities are preparing for possible conflicts, fueled by past unrest over misinformation online.
